Defining Roles: The Unique Tasks of a listing agent and a buyers agent
Within the real estate field, agents often specialize in serving either vendors or buyers. Knowing the separation between a listing agent and a buyers agent is vital for a successful transaction. Both kinds of real estate agent plays a distinct and vital part in the transaction. Below are several key aspects:
- A listing agent chiefly represents the vendor, aiming to promote the property effectively and get the best possible price and terms.
- On the other hand, a buyers agent exclusively works with the buyer, guiding them to identify a appropriate property and discuss its purchase.}
- The listing agent manages duties including property valuation, creating promotional content, arranging showings, and discussing terms on behalf of the seller.
- A buyers agent offers purchasers with access to homes for sale, arranges property viewings, guides on making an offer, and assists with appraisals.
- Both the listing agent and the buyers agent often compensated through a commission that is covered from the transaction funds at closing, though specific arrangements can vary.
Essentially, both types of realtor work diligently to enable a positive real estate outcome for their respective clients. Selecting the correct type of real estate agent is determined by whether you are marketing or acquiring property.

Finding Your Guide: Key Considerations for Hiring a real estate agent
Selecting the perfect real estate agent is a critical decision in your real estate endeavor. This professional will be your partner, so it is crucial to choose a professional who comprehends your requirements and you can trust. Evaluate their track record, particularly with your type of transaction in your area. A knowledgeable realtor should possess comprehensive understanding of inventory levels and proven deal-making abilities. Don't hesitate to check reviews from past clients to understand their professionalism. Additionally, ensure they are officially registered and affiliated with recognized real estate organizations, which often indicates adherence to a strict code of ethics, whether they are a listing agent or a buyers agent. Finally, a great real estate agent will communicate effectively, be proactive, and work tirelessly to meet your goals.
